Description

This unusual conversation piece produces in abundance strange looking green and white flowers in late summer. It has a unique method of pollination. The tubular 2½ inch flowers are lined inside with downward pointing hairs that temporarily trap insects. They are then released the next day covered with pollen. With thick leafless twining stems, it is best displayed in a hanging basket. Plant in partial shade with a well-draining cactus mix and allow to dry out between waterings. Needs protection from freezing. Native to South Africa. 



Ceropegia Ampliata is a rare and unusual succulent vine that originates from South Africa. It is related to the popular string of hearts plant (ceropegia woodii). The twining succulent stems have rudimentary leaves and the plant develops fleshy succulent roots. The plant is known for its large, eye-catching flowers that are produced in abundance at the end of summer that give rise to its common names.
